TY - JOUR PY - 2007// TI - Digital information support for domestic violence victims JO - Journal of the American Society for Information Science and Technology A1 - Westbrook, Lynn SP - 420 EP - 432 VL - 58 IS - 3 N2 - With domestic violence directly impacting over 5 million victims in the United States annually, the growing e-health and e-government networks are developing digitally based resources for both victims and those who aid them. The well-established community information and referral role of public libraries dovetails with this digital referral network model; however, no study of the actual service provided by public libraries is available. This examination of e-mail reference responses to requests for safe-house contact information revealed major gaps in cyber-safety awareness and uneven implementation of professional standards for virtual reference service. Implications for information system design, professional standards, education, and future research are discussed.
